How to get Canon MF 4412 to scan

Hi I've just purchased a Canon Image class multifunctional printer MF 4412. I have it printing OK but scaning is not working. When USB plugged in it doesn't recognise my Macbook pro. Do I need to install seperate scanner drivers? Or do I need to get scaning software?
Thanks for the help

Canon has the MF ScanGear v1.30 for Mac OS X. With this software installed you can then set the MF Scan button online (showing USB Scanner or something similar) and then use either the MF Toolbox application (included with the driver) to scan or use Preview to scan your document.

  • How to get Canon Printer to work wired?

    I have a canon wireless printer. I just got a cable for it as i want to not use wifi to print from my computer.
    How do i get my Canon printer to work with the cable in it.
    computer is a IMAc
    printer canon MP560 colour
    I have cable in it now. How do i get it to work wired to computer? thanks

    System Preferences - Printing & Scanning highlight your printer and right click and choose Reset Printing System. Next turn off the printer, then restart the computer in Safe Mode which will clear some caches. To restart in Safe Mode, simply hold down the Shift Key when you hear the startup tone until a progress bar appears. Then shut down the computer, connect the USB cable from the printer to the computer and start the compute normally, then turn on the printer and your iMac should find it. If your computer does not find the printer follow Apple's instructions for doing so.

  • I recently downloaded LION. How do I get my Nikon Cool IV scan driver to work?

    I recently downloaded LION. How do I get my Nikon Cool IV scan driver to work?

    You probably can't. Nikon says that Nikon Scan, last updated over two years ago, isn't fully compatible even with Mac OS X 10.5. It probably won't work with Lion at all. Nikon suggests a third party software option such as Vuescan from Hamrick.com or Silverfast software. Both companys say that their software does support the CoolScan IV and is compatible with Lion.

  • How to get accurate photo printouts using calibrated FlexScan S1932 , Photoshop CS3 and Canon MX925 ? ALL ARE calibrated with i1Pro . WHO SHOULD GOVERN THE PRINTOUT , THE CS3 OR THE PRINTER ?

    How to get accurate photo printouts using  FlexScan S1932 screen, Photoshop CS3 and Canon MX925 ? ALL ARE calibrated with i1Pro . WHO SHOULD GOVERN THE PRINTOUT , THE CS3 OR THE PRINTER ?

    You need to work with the calibration parameters to get a good match from screen to print. There are no fixed values - basically whatever settings produce a match are the right ones.
    First, set the white point - luminance and color - so that screen white is a visual equivalent to paper white. You can be very specific about this, with a viewing booth right next to the display and a particular paper as target. Or you can take a more generalistic approach. That too will usually work well, as long as you keep the aim in sight: screen white = paper white.
    Don't trust the white point presets. You will usually have to adjust to compensate for your working environment. Make sure you can adjust both along the blue/yellow Kelvin scale and the green/magenta axis. Any given Kelvin value may well be wrong on the green/magenta axis.
    Next set a realistic black point. This is important. Monitor manufacturers throw about completely unrealistic contrast ranges that you will never see on paper. A good glossy inkjet paper will be in the vicinity of 250-300:1, or a black point around 0.4 - 0.5 cd/m² if your white point is at 120. If you have a monitor that goes down to, say, 0.2, which most monitors today will, you're in for an unpleasant surprise.
    Leave gamma at 2.2. Gamma is remapped from profile to profile and is "invisible" - the net result is always linear. You just want to stay close to native so that the monitor behaves at its best.
    If you have a wide gamut monitor soft proofing in Photoshop can be useful. With a standard gamut monitor it's mostly a waste of time since monitor gamut is the limiting one.
    Oh, and let Photoshop manage color. Make sure you have the right paper/ink profile and also make sure you have the right paper selected in the printer driver. This controls the total amount of ink.
